linux的echo是什么
时间: 2023-08-31 21:18:48 浏览: 47
### 回答1:
在 Linux 操作系统中,echo 是一个命令行工具,它用于将一个或多个字符串输出到标准输出设备(通常是终端窗口)。该命令可以用于打印变量、文本和其他数据。echo 命令的语法如下:
```
echo [string]
```
其中,string 是要输出的字符串。如果 string 中包含空格或其他特殊字符,需要使用引号将其括起来,以避免命令解释器对其进行解释。例如:
```
echo "Hello, World!"
```
将输出字符串 "Hello, World!" 到终端窗口。
### 回答2:
Linux中的echo是一个命令行工具,用于在终端上输出字符或字符串。它的主要作用是将信息打印到屏幕上,同时也可以将信息重定向到文件中。
使用echo命令非常简单,只需在终端输入"echo",紧接着是要输出的内容,然后按下回车键即可输出内容到屏幕上。例如,输入"echo Hello World",将在终端上打印出"Hello World"这个字符串。
echo命令还可以与其他命令和变量配合使用。通过使用特殊字符"$",我们可以输出变量的值。例如,输入"echo $PATH",将输出环境变量PATH的值,即系统命令的搜索路径。
此外,echo命令还支持反斜杠(\)转义字符,可以在输出时插入特殊字符,如换行符(\n)、制表符(\t)和退格(\b)等,以实现格式化输出。
在Linux中,echo命令还具有重定向功能。通过使用">"符号,我们可以将输出目标从屏幕转为文件。例如,输入"echo Hello World > output.txt",将把"Hello World"写入到名为output.txt的文件中。
总之,Linux中的echo是一个简单而强大的命令行工具,用于输出字符、字符串和变量到屏幕上或文件中。它对于在终端操作、脚本编写和调试等方面都非常有用。
### 回答3:
echo是一个在Linux系统中的命令行工具,用于在终端或脚本中输出文本或变量的值。它是一个非常常用和灵活的命令,可以用来在终端上显示文本、创建文件、向文件中写入内容以及进行字符串的拼接等操作。
使用echo命令时,可以通过在命令后面添加要输出的文本或变量,以及使用一些特殊字符来实现不同的功能。例如,使用echo命令输出文本时,可以直接在命令后面添加要输出的内容,然后该内容就会显示在终端上。另外,还可以使用特殊字符来实现一些控制输出的功能,比如换行符"\n"用于在输出文本时换行,制表符"\t"用于输出制表符等。
除了输出文本外,echo命令还可以用于将文本写入文件中。可以通过使用重定向符号">"将echo命令的输出保存到指定的文件中,从而创建新的文件或者覆盖原有文件的内容。此外,还可以使用重定向符号">>"将echo命令的输出追加到文件的末尾,而不是覆盖原有文件的内容。
除了输出静态文本外,echo命令还可以输出变量的值。通过在命令后面加上"$"符号和变量名,可以将变量的值输出到终端上。这使得echo命令成为了在脚本中输出变量值的常用工具。
总之,Linux中的echo命令是一个功能强大、灵活易用的命令行工具,可以用于在终端上输出文本、创建文件、写入文件内容以及输出变量的值。它在系统管理、脚本编写和日常使用中都有着广泛的应用。